Would it be inappropriate to measure the distance from Pluto to Earth in light-years?

Light years aren't the best, since it is only about 0.000624 light years away. Saying that the distance is 39 AU would be better. On the other hand, it's a much better unit than saying the distance is 3,229,510,630,000 fathoms.


What do light years measure in astronomy?

Light years measure distance in astronomy. It is the distance that light travels in one year, which is about 9.46 trillion kilometers.
